原文:MongoDB 如何实现备份压缩

背景及原理 数据库的备份是灾难恢复的最后一道屏障,不管什么类型的数据库都需要设置数据库备份,MongoDB也不例外。MongoDB . 后 ,数据库可以采用Wiredtiger存储引擎后 . 版本默认 ,在此环境下通过mongodump 备份后,产生的备份文件要远大于数据存储文件的大小。此外,一般MongoDB存储的数据量比较大,备份文件也比较大,占用了很多磁盘空间。所以,研究如何实现MongoD ...

2018-09-05 20:00 0 3222 推荐指数:

查看详情

mongodb备份

转载请附原文链接:http://www.cnblogs.com/wingsless/p/5672057.html mongodb现在为止还是没有像XtraBackup这样好用的备份工具,因此一般来说会有两种备份办法:拷贝文件和mongodump。拷贝文件这招在MySQL里经常用 ...

Fri Jul 15 07:04:00 CST 2016 1 7010
用shell脚本实现MongoDB数据库自动备份

一、创建MongoDB备份目录 用来存放数据 mkdir -p /data/mongodb_bak/mongodb_bak_now mkdir -p /data/mongodb_bak/mongodb_bak_list 二、创建MongoDB数据库备份脚本 ...

Thu May 23 00:44:00 CST 2019 0 492
xtrabackup备份之xbstream压缩

1、介绍 线上的生产环境在数据备份的时候,使用--stream=tar压缩压缩的时候发现系统根目录下面的/tmp会变大;因为根目录空间不是很大,只有30个G左右;压缩过程中会撑爆/tmp目录;查资料发现在使用tar压缩时,会把xtrabackup_logfile文件写到MySQL的tmpdir ...

Wed Dec 09 23:20:00 CST 2020 0 641
xtrabackup备份之xbstream压缩

线上的生产环境在数据备份的时候,使用--stream=tar压缩压缩的时候发现系统根目录下面的/tmp会变大;因为根目录空间不是很大,只有30个G左右;压缩过程中会撑爆/tmp目录;查资料发现在使用tar压缩时,会把xtrabackup_logfile文件写到MySQL的tmpdir指定的目录中 ...

Mon Dec 30 19:08:00 CST 2019 0 2465
xtrabackup 开启压缩备份

完整备份innobackupex --defaults-file=/etc/my.cnf --host=localhost --user=bkpuser --password=s3cret /data/dbbak/innobackupex/ --no-timestamp --compress ...

Sat Dec 03 09:57:00 CST 2016 0 1504
挖一挖MongoDB备份与还原(实现指定时间点还原和增量备份还原)

一 研究背景需求 目前作者所在公司的MongoDB数据库是每天凌晨做一次全库完整备份,但数据库出现故障时,只能保证恢复到全备时间点,比如,00:30 做的完整备份,而出现故障是下午18:00,那么现有的备份机制只可以恢复到00:30,即丢失00:30 – 18:00 的操作数 ...

Tue Oct 23 08:20:00 CST 2018 3 2612
MongoDB的常规备份策略

MongoDB备份其实算是一个基本操作,最近总是有人问起,看来很多人对这里还不太熟悉。为了避免一次又一次地重复解释,特总结成一篇博客供后来者查阅。如有不尽正确之处请指正。 1. 内建方法 1.1 复制数据库文件 不用多做解释,几乎对任何数据库都有用,简单粗暴。但像多数数据库一样,这个操作 ...

Thu Sep 24 09:19:00 CST 2015 2 18274
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M